One of the most striking benefits of GFS tanks is their exceptional durability. These tanks are constructed from high-strength steel that undergoes a glass-fusion process at high temperatures. This fusion creates a smooth, non-porous surface that is resistant to corrosion, making GFS tanks an ideal choice for storage environments that are prone to harsh conditions, such as wastewater treatment facilities or agricultural applications. Unlike traditional steel tanks, GFS tanks do not require protective coatings or paint, significantly reducing maintenance costs over their lifespan.

Additionally, GFS tanks are known for their quick installation process. Unlike traditional concrete or welded steel tanks that can take a significant amount of time to install, GFS tanks can be assembled and operational in a fraction of the time. This expedited installation process not only reduces labor costs but also minimizes downtime, allowing organizations to get back to business faster.

Moreover, the environmental impact of GFS tanks is worth noting. The glass-fused coating minimizes the leaching of contaminants into the stored contents. This is crucial in sectors where product purity is essential, such as food and beverage or pharmaceuticals. By opting for GFS tanks, companies can enhance compliance with environmental regulations while maintaining the integrity of their products.

It is also essential to consider the safety aspect of GFS tanks. When properly installed, these tanks form a stable and secure structure capable of withstanding fluctuations in temperature and pressure. This stability is particularly vital in industries that handle hazardous materials, as it minimizes the risk of spills or leaks. Additionally, the smooth surface of GFS tanks prevents the accumulation of microbial growth and contaminants, ensuring that stored contents remain safe for consumption or use.
